The Growth Hormone Releasing Peptide, In Plain Words
Many adults notice changes as they age. Natural growth hormone levels begin a gradual decline after the mid-twenties. This decrease can affect energy, sleep quality, muscle tone, and even body composition. You might experience less stamina for your daily activities or a slower recovery from workouts.
This is where a specific type of peptide therapy can become relevant. It works by stimulating your own pituitary gland to release more growth hormone. Think of it as a gentle nudge to your body’s natural production system. It doesn’t introduce synthetic hormones. Instead, it encourages your system to function more robustly, mimicking the pulsatile release patterns seen in younger years.
The primary compound used is a synthetic GHRH analog, also known as sermorelin acetate. It is a biomimetic peptide. This means it closely resembles a naturally occurring hormone in your body. Its structure allows it to bind to specific receptors in your pituitary gland. This binding triggers the release of endogenous growth hormone.
Understanding the Mechanism
This therapy functions by targeting the anterior pituitary gland. It acts as a secretagogue, a substance that stimulates secretion. Specifically, it stimulates the release of growth hormone. Unlike direct growth hormone administration, this approach leverages your body’s inherent feedback mechanisms. This can contribute to a more physiological response.
The benefits reported by some patients include improved sleep patterns. They often note increased energy levels and better workout recovery. Changes in body composition, such as a reduction in body fat and an increase in lean muscle mass, are also commonly mentioned. These effects stem from the role of growth hormone in metabolism and tissue repair.
Key Lab Markers and Their Role
Monitoring certain lab markers is crucial when considering this type of protocol. Insulin-like Growth Factor 1 (IGF-1) is a key indicator. It is produced primarily by the liver in response to growth hormone. Elevated IGF-1 levels often correlate with increased growth hormone activity. Your clinician will likely review your IGF-1 levels to assess your baseline and track progress.
Other important markers may include fasting glucose levels. This helps ensure the therapy does not negatively impact your blood sugar. A comprehensive blood panel provides a complete picture of your health. This allows for personalized treatment adjustments.

Compounded Medications and Regulations
It is important to understand that compounded sermorelin acetate is dispensed under specific regulatory frameworks. These are sections 503A and 503B of the Food, Drug, and Cosmetic Act. This is not the same as separate FDA approval for a mass-produced drug. The compounding pharmacy prepares the medication based on the individual prescription from your licensed clinician.

How is sermorelin acetate different from HGH?
Sermorelin acetate is a GHRH analog that stimulates your pituitary gland to produce its own growth hormone. Human Growth Hormone (HGH) therapy involves directly administering synthetic HGH. The peptide therapy works with your body’s natural cycles, whereas direct HGH administration bypasses them.
